Funny enough this sketch was actually based on a true story. The Mill's brothers did play in Steubenville and encouraged Dean in the early days before he teamed up with Jerry. Dean never forgot them. To show his appreciation The Mills Brothers appeared on Dean's T.V. show many times over the years.

The reason why Dean is wearing a white jacket, is because he is recreating the time when he met the Mills Brothers the very first time way back when.Back then, Dean would come out wearing a white jacket back in the day. Dean looked a little nervous and a little stiff, so Harry Mills suggested that he would light up a cigarette, and have a drink or two to calm down his nerves. And that was that. Then, when he begin working with Jerry Lewis, he didn't have the cigarette nor did he have the booze; it was after the partnership broke up, that he needed to reinvent himself with a new image and that's when he began using the cigarette, and and a glass in the other hand as part of his props on stage. It was reported by many, that it was nothing other than Apple juice, and once in a while iced tea in the glass. (To give it the illusion as if it was alcohol ) however, he did admit in several interviews, that he would have a glass of wine🍷 or two only with dinner; and that was about it. On stage and on T.V. it would usually be apple juice, or Ice tea his prop guy mentioned. It was also believed that after his son Dean Paul Jr. Passed away, he then began drinking heavily.
